<p>Globe is stepping up its efforts to make reliable, high-speed internet accessible to more Filipino households. By focusing on both fiber and 5G technologies, the company is working to deliver affordable, flexible, and high-quality connectivity to communities across the country.</p>



<p>“Connectivity is an enabler of progress,” said Carl Cruz, Globe’s President and Chief Executive Officer. “By expanding our network infrastructure, we are unlocking access to education, healthcare, and economic opportunities for millions of Filipinos. Globe remains steadfast in working with industry partners and the government to ensure inclusive digital access.”</p>



<p>What makes GFiber Prepaid (GFP) really stand out is how well it fits into the everyday lives of users. A lot of SEC D households prefer services that don’t tie them down with contracts or require big upfront payments. GFP gets that, offering a simple plug-and-play setup, reloadable options, and easy management through the GlobeOne app. Most users top up every 3 to 4 weeks, which keeps them connected without breaking the bank. It’s all about giving them the flexibility they need while keeping costs manageable.</p>



<p>This focus on customer satisfaction is clearly making an impact. GFP’s Net Promoter Score (NPS) is an impressive 67, way above the Telco Industry average of 31 (Transaction NPS). It just goes to show how much users value not only the speed but the whole prepaid fiber experience. Customers appreciate the convenience and control it offers, making it a top pick for more Filipino households.</p>



<p>Globe is also expanding reload options through AMAX and ECPay. This means users have more ways to stay connected, no matter what their routine looks like.</p>



<p>On top of fiber connectivity, Globe is also pushing its 5G WiFi through Fixed Wireless Access (FWA). This tech makes it possible to deliver fast, reliable internet in places where fiber just isn’t practical, especially in underserved communities. This approach not only helps cover areas lacking fiber connectivity but also offloads traffic from Globe’s mobile network, improving overall service quality.</p>



<p>Looking ahead, Globe has laid out a clear plan for 2025: expand access, deepen engagement, and enhance the customer experience. This approach ensures that both new and long-time users enjoy better connectivity designed around their needs.</p>



<p>Globe is also working to close the digital gap in remote areas. The goal is to bring fiber connectivity to 100 more Geographically Isolated and Disadvantaged Areas (GIDAs), giving people in these communities access to digital services that were previously out of reach. By the end of 2025, Globe plans to increase the number of cell sites in these areas from 600 to 700, helping more Filipinos stay online and connected.<br></p>

<p>Globe has successfully deployed the Philippines&#8217; first fully functional Private 5G Network designed to address major operational pain points and challenges in different industries.</p>



<p>Installed at a Globe facility in Makati City, this dedicated, on-premise wireless network showcases the potential of 5G to power advanced digital solutions that support critical functions with utmost reliability and efficiency.</p>



<p>Unlike traditional public networks shared by multiple users, Globe’s Private 5G Network offers businesses a dedicated bandwidth, providing a higher level of control and security over their network environment.  </p>



<p>It also enables customization to deliver high-performance, low-latency, and secure connectivity exclusive to a specific organization, facility, or operation.</p>



<p>The service will soon be available to Globe’s Business-to-Business (B2B) clients, including those in ports, mining, and manufacturing, unlocking new possibilities across various sectors.</p>



<p>&#8220;This milestone demonstrates our drive to provide cutting-edge connectivity solutions that cater to the varying needs of our clients,” said Gerhard Tan, Senior Director and Head of Technology Strategy and Innovations at Globe.&nbsp; “As businesses and organizations continue to adapt to the rapidly changing technological landscape, Globe’s private 5G network solution will be a key enabler in overcoming connectivity challenges, enabling new applications for different use cases and driving the next wave of digital transformation.”</p>



<p>To ensure its private 5G solutions remain at the forefront of innovation, Globe has been working closely with leading technology providers, systems integrators, and global enterprises.</p>



<p>The pilot run, done in partnership with Nokia Shanghai Bell, featured the integration of a Video Surveillance and Analytics Solution that enables people counting, facial recognition, gender detection, and vehicle plate tracking.</p>



<p>These capabilities are particularly beneficial in ensuring operational safety, workforce management, and asset tracking, to help businesses operate more efficiently and securely.</p>

<p><a></a>Leading digital solutions platform Globe expanded its 5G coverage to 212 sites in Visayas and 25 in Mindanao by the end of the third quarter in 2022, providing more consumers and businesses with improved connectivity and access to faster data speeds.</p>



<p><a></a>The company’s 5G network is now expanding and available to most of the population in Davao City, Cebu, Iloilo City, Zamboanga City, Cagayan de Oro City, Boracay and Bacolod City.&nbsp;</p>



<p><a></a>The expansion of 5G technology in Visayas and Mindanao is intended to help bridge the digital divide between these regions and the rest of the country. It aims to support economic development and enable residents to access a wider range of digital services and opportunities.</p>



<p><a></a>The deployment is also beneficial to the growth of new industries and businesses in the said areas. It can inspire innovation and competitiveness as companies seek to provide the best possible services to their customers.</p>



<p><a></a>“We believe that the expansion of 5G technology in Visayas and Mindanao is essential for driving economic growth, supporting innovation, and providing access to fast and reliable digital services for residents and businesses in these regions.&nbsp; It will also help spur further investment and support the emergence of a vibrant and dynamic digital economy,” said&nbsp;Joel Agustin, Globe Senior Vice President for Network Planning &amp; Engineering.</p>



<p><a></a>As a pioneering provider of 5G technology in the Philippines, Globe is committed to delivering improved customer service and reliable, consistent data services to its customers.</p>



<p><a></a>By scaling up the rollout of its 5G network, Globe is taking a major step towards building a more connected and technologically advanced society in the Philippines.&nbsp; It is helping drive the adoption of 5G technology and paving the way for the next generation of digital innovation.</p>



<p><a></a>5G technology is capable of delivering internet speeds up to 100 times faster than 4G. It also has less lag, making it suitable for video streaming and gaming.</p>

<p>Globe leads the 5G supremacy race in the Philippines with 1,069 areas across the country now with this latest generation in wireless technology.&nbsp; At present, Globe has the widest 5G footprint in the country owing to the company&#8217;s aggressive network builds and site upgrades.</p>



<p>As of January this year, Globe&#8217;s 5G coverage is present in 848 locations in Metro Manila and Rizal; and in 221 areas in Visayas and Mindanao.</p>



<p>“We want our customers to unlock the many possibilities and potential that 5G technology brings.&nbsp;Getting the 5G service to more customers supports our vision of empowering Filipinos to create the quality of lives they want,” said Ernest Cu, Globe’s President and CEO.</p>



<p>5G is the latest in wireless technology that promises faster speeds, higher bandwidth, and more stable internet connection compared to 4G.</p>



<p>In Visayas, 5G is now accessible in several areas in Negros Occidental, Cebu, Iloilo and in Aklan. The technology is likewise available in some areas in Misamis Oriental and Davao del Sur.&nbsp; In South Luzon, 5G is already present in selected locations in Laguna and Bulacan.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p dir="ltr">Keeping true to its promise of bringing the latest technology to other parts of the country, Globe has expanded its 5G coverage to 17 key cities in Metro Manila, Visayas and Mindanao.</p>
<p dir="ltr">The company is accelerating upgrades of its existing technology to improve further the connectivity, mobile experience, and unlock vast potentials for its customers as 5G technology in Bacolod, Boracay, Iloilo, Talisay, Lapu-Lapu, Cordova, Minglanilla  and Cebu City in Visayas; and in Davao City and Cagayan De Oro in Mindanao becomes available.</p>
<p dir="ltr">In the first week of November, its 5G network has already reached certain areas in Davao City. Globe customers are encouraged to get their 5G capable mobile devices via the postpaid plans available on the Globe online store (<a href="http://shop.globe.com.ph/"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er" data-saferedirecturl="https://www.google.com/url?q=http://shop.globe.com.ph&amp;source=gmail&amp;ust=1605764761517000&amp;usg=AFQjCNF7hZtP9bEo-7zkGv9fAOlr4S61MA">shop.globe.com.ph</a>) or from Globe stores in Davao City so they can experience the jaw-dropping speeds and other potentials of 5G.</p>
<p dir="ltr">5G is the latest wireless internet connectivity that promises faster speeds, higher bandwidth, and more stable internet connections compared to 4G.</p>
<p dir="ltr">“We have a very active 5G development in Metro Manila and we hope to cover 80% of that soon. We are probably in the two-thirds range right now. To complement this, we have also begun to roll out in six key cities in Visayas and Mindanao as part of the overall change we are making to bring 5G to more places and customers in the country,” said Gil Genio, Globe’s Chief Technology and Information Officer.</p>
<p dir="ltr">In Metro Manila, Globe has added more additional sites to widen its total areas with 5G availability, currently on track for its target to cover around 80% of Metro Manila by the end of 2020.</p>
<p dir="ltr">Globe’s aggression on 5G rollout is part of its 3-pronged strategy for network upgrades and expansion, which includes aggressive cell site builds; upgrading its cell sites to 4G/LTE using many different frequencies; and fast-tracking the fiberization of Filipino homes nationwide.</p>

<p style="font-weight: 400;">There is no stopping the digital revolution. We’ve rapidly breezed past 1G to 2G then 3G to 4G. And just when almost everybody thought it’s too good to be true, Globe proudly launched last night (June 20) at the BGC Amphitheater in Taguig City, its fifth-generation (5G) fixed wireless broadband through its Globe At Home Air Fiber 5G postpaid plans.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">The excitement and curiosity building around the 5G was intense at the media launch. Many in the audience, perhaps, wanted to pinch themselves until Globe President and CEO Ernest Cu took to the stage to confirm it.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">“The arrival of 5G has caused excitement in the global world of telecommunications. Today, we made a crucial step in fulfilling our goal of connecting more Filipino homes, and our vision of bringing first-world Internet to the Philippines,” Cu said.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">And just like that, it’s really here through Globe’s use of the latest technology encapsulated in Huawei’s 5G CPE Pro multimode modem chipset, making the Philippines the first in Southeast Asia and most of the world to support the commercial application of the fastest Internet peak download speeds.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">With the advent of Globe At Home Air Fiber 5G, Cu promised to see change in the digital experience Filipino homes. It is with this super fast Internet connection that Globe sees to reinforce the efforts of achieving the company’s goal to connect two million homes by 2020.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">“This is our goal to make connectivity fast and make every home have quality time whether the children are studying, watching movie, downloading, playing games and a lot more,” said Cu.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">“Prior to Air Fiber 5G, we have aggressively utilized fixed wireless solutions to connect more homes and businesses to the internet over airwaves. This strategy resulted in home broadband subscriber base increasing by 55.1% to 1.7 million in the first three months of 2019 from 1.1 million in the same period in 2016,” he added.</p>
<p>In the crowd, one could get a sense that Filipinos – one of the most social media-active nations in the world – are marching right into the future. After the event, though, there were mixed reactions amid the realization that the country still needs to catch up on developing telecoms infrastructure.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">This is no secret to Globe as it was Cu who even admitted that while the company endeavors to connect more Filipinos at home through its Globe at Home Air Fiber 5G, he said: “There are external challenges of rolling out fiber optic cables in the country.”</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;"><strong>The plan and the place</strong></p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">For this reason, the Globe At Home Air Fiber 5G postpaid plans which offer fiber-like speeds up to 100Mbps and super-sized data packages of up to 2 terabytes will be initially available only in selected areas in Pasig City, Cavite, and Bulacan.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">Globe at Home Air Fiber 5G will be available to eligible customers in July 2019. Plans come at P1899 per month for up to 20Mbps, P2499 for up to 50Mbps and P2899 for up to 100Mbps. All come with up to 2TB data capacity.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">“Globe At Home Air Fiber 5G makes use of fixed location wireless radios instead of fiber optic cables which enables the company to go over the circuitous approval process of deploying a fiber optic cable &#8211; a task which proves to be arduous and involves securing multiple permits from local government units (LGUs),” Cu said. “The right of process can sometimes take years to obtain, causing drastic delays in fiber optic roll-out completion,” he added.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">Cu said that the company has been spending over 21 percent of its annual total revenues to upgrade and expand its telecommunication and IT infrastructure since 2012.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">“We have been ramping up our capital spend from P20.3 billion in 2012 to P43.3 billion in 2018, in order to provide our customers better broadband services,” he said.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;"><strong>State-of-the-art technology</strong></p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">In his Facebook post, Art Samaniego Jr., editor of Manila Bulletin’s Tech News, explained the cutting-edge technology employed by Globe. “5G arrives in the country via Globe using Huawei technology. HUAWEI 5G CPE Pro is the world’s first 5G multimode modem chipset. The power of the chipset enables the router to be the first to support commercial application of 4G and 5G dual-modes. It is the first to have the capacity to perform to industry benchmarks of peak 5G download speeds. The dual-mode elements allow for the device to use 4G if the 5G signal is not strong enough,” said Samaniego.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">He added: “The HUAWEI 5G CPE Pro supports up to 1.6 Gbps speeds in commercial network for ultra-high definition visual communications and immersive multimedia interactions. It also utilises dedicated video channel and game accelerator channel technology for 8K media or Computer Graphic VR gaming.”</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;"><strong>First Filipinos on 5G</strong></p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">That is why Cu was proud of this development as he thanked those who helped the Globe team make 5G a historical reality in the telecommunications industry in the Philippines, only the third country in Asia after Japan and South Korea to deploy 5G for commercial applications.</p>
<p style="font-weight: 400;">5G technology enables the use of Internet of Things (IoT) for today’s intelligent homes. Internet connection that is faster, more secure and with lower latency brought by 5G significantly enhanced entertainment and security systems at home, promising a digital experience that is more seamless, reliable and intuitive for the modern Filipino household.</p>

<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="8avnf-0-0"><span data-offset-key="8avnf-0-0">Globe continues to invest in its network to support the increasing demand for data services of its customers. For the first three months of 2019, Globe spent around P8.8 billion in capital expenditures or 24%of topline revenues. About 68% of the total expenditures for this period was for data-related services.</span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="7mvce-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="7mvce-0-0"><span data-offset-key="7mvce-0-0"> </span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="9pgo5-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="9pgo5-0-0"><span data-offset-key="9pgo5-0-0">Globe closed the first three months of 2019 with consolidated service revenues1 of P36.0 billion, up 13% from a year ago and 3% higher from prior quarter. This was mainly fueled by sustained increase in data usage across all data-related services and products, including the wide array of content offerings, through the Company’s partnerships with global content providers.</span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="e69bm-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="e69bm-0-0"><span data-offset-key="e69bm-0-0"> </span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="3vjn6-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="3vjn6-0-0"><span data-offset-key="3vjn6-0-0"><span data-offset-key="3vjn6-0-0">Mobile revenues for the period grew close to P27.0 billion, up 11% from the same period of 2018 and 4% higher from the previous quarter, mostly coming from the Prepaid brands. From a product perspective, mobile data revenues amounted to P16.5. billion for the first three months of the year, due to the surge in consumer spending on mobile data, given the rising popularity of promos that provide the best surfing deals. Mobile data continued to be the top contributor to the company&#8217;s total mobile business, and  </span></span>now accounts for 61% of gross service revenues from 47% a year ago. Globe is now reaping the benefits of its modernized 4G/LTE network that allows more of its customers to experience faster content downloads, smoother music and video streaming, and richer web browsing experiences, thus the mobile data traffic growth from 180 petabytes in same period of 2018 to 370 petabytes this period. Meanwhile, mobile voice and mobile SMS revenues for the period just ended posted P6.3 billion and P4.2 billion, lower year-on-year by 15% and 22%, respectively.</p>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="9mr30-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="9mr30-0-0"><span data-offset-key="9mr30-0-0"> </span></div>
</div>
</div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="b9n17-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="b9n17-0-0"><span data-offset-key="b9n17-0-0">In view of the new regulatory requirement of one (1) year extension of prepaid load validity, Globe closed the first three months of 2019 with a total mobile subscriber base of 83.5 million, up 13% from the fourth quarter of 2018.</span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="2q61i-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="2q61i-0-0"><span data-offset-key="2q61i-0-0"> </span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="dkqm2-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="dkqm2-0-0"><span data-offset-key="dkqm2-0-0">Globe’s home broadband business posted a robust 21% increase from a year ago and 3% against the prior quarter to reach P5.2 billion this period. Home broadband’s resilient performance, was attributed to subscriber expansion in fixed wireless solutions, supported by the affordable, flexible home broadband bundles plus the increasing popularity of Home Prepaid Wi-Fi. Total home broadband subscriber base now stands at over 1.7 million, up 22% from a year ago and around 63% are fixed wireless subscribers.</span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="fuqpb-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="fuqpb-0-0"><span data-offset-key="fuqpb-0-0"> </span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="6f008-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="6f008-0-0"><span data-offset-key="6f008-0-0">Moreover, corporate data business showed a notable 16% year-on-year growth from the P2.7 billion revenues from same period of 2018. This was mainly from internet and domestic services coupled with the 5% higher circuit count.</span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="a4k8s-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="a4k8s-0-0"><span data-offset-key="a4k8s-0-0"> </span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="f6j9u-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="f6j9u-0-0"><span data-offset-key="f6j9u-0-0">Globe’s total operating expenses and subsidy amounted to P16.1 billion for the period, or 1% higher year- on-year.</span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="3vlpa-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="3vlpa-0-0"><span data-offset-key="3vlpa-0-0"> </span></div>
</div>
<div class="" data-block="true" data-editor="6df36" data-offset-key="3jt6j-0-0">
<div class="_1mf _1mj" data-offset-key="3jt6j-0-0"><span data-offset-key="3jt6j-0-0">Consolidated EBITDA closed the first three months of 2019 with a total of P19.9 billion, up 24% versus last year, as this period’s topline gains fully offset the slight increase in expenses. EBITDA margin was at 55% this period compared to 50% from a year ago. Net income stood at P6.7 billion, 44% higher from a year ago, mainly due to the robust EBITDA growth, offsetting depreciation charges and non-operating expenses booked for the period just ended. Depreciation expenses remained high this period given Globe’s continued network expansion and acceleration of its LTE and broadband rollout. Core net income, which excludes the impact of non-recurring charges, and foreign exchange and mark-to-market charges, stood at P6.7 billion, 40% increase from same period of 2018.</span></div>
